While migrating PST Files into a mailbox the import randomly fails. The State of the affected PST after the migration tasks is finished is:
PST migration of \\CUSTOMERFSP03FS2\J$\groups\00040205\KEMP.pst: Error 0x80004005
A dtrace shows me this error:
258283 12:41:20.813 [5112] (PstMigratorTask) <MigratorThread:5428> EV-H {PstLogFile.LogError} Could not get PST migration status of PST \\CUSTOMERFSP03FS2\J$\groups\00040205\KEMP.pst: The RPC server is unavailable. (Exception from HRESULT: 0x800706BA)
258284 12:41:20.813 [5112] (PstMigratorTask) <MigratorThread:5428> EV-H {PstLogFile.LogError} PST migration of \\CUSTOMERFSP03FS2\J$\groups\00040205\KEMP.pst: Error 0x80004005
I reproduced this error with 5 PST´s i´ve created from the same source outlook. I´ve copied them to the File server. The locate and collect tasks have been finished successfully. When i set the state to "Ready to migrate" again then the import will run again an if i´m lucky the import is sucessfull. But for some PST Fiels that seem to have no difference to others i´ve needed 5 tries.
The main problem is that the user get´s the message that the pst import was successfull and the contents seem to be imported successfully (archive is filled and shortcuts in the mailbox have been generated) but as an administrator i see the failed state and try to import the pst´files again. SO it seems to be a problem of the response. So the elements will be imported a few times.
We plan to import ~8TB PST Files. So i can´t handle the import if this issue persists. I thougt that i´t´s maybe related to this topic: https://www.veritas.com/support/en_US/article.TECH76080 and already opeened the WMI Ports. But without success.
EV 11.01, Windows Server 2012 R2

Meanwhile Veritas support acknowledged that it´s a Bug in EV11. Unfortunately they do not plan to fix it in V11.
